Web18 de ago. de 2024 · The Hovis commercial was filmed by director Sir Ridley Scott who went on make Alien, Gladiator, Blade Runner and Thelma and Louise. In the advert, Mr Barlow struggles to push a bike laden with freshly baked bread up the steep hill to ‘Old Ma Peggotty’s house’, the last customer on his round. WebIn 1973, Hovis ran a television advertisement, Boy on the Bike, written by advertising agency Collett Dickenson Pearce and filmed by CDP's photographer Jack Bankhead under the direction of Ridley Scott, who …
